Secret Technical Considerations for the UK MarketEnergy Efficiency Ratings
Because the introduction of the brand-new energy labels in 2021, a lot of home appliances now fall into classifications C, D, or E. It is a common mistaken belief that there are numerous "A" rated refrigerators on the market; in reality, the new scale is much more stringent. Constantly check the energy label to see the annual kilowatt-hour (kWh) intake to estimate long-lasting running costs.
Climate Class
The UK is a temperate climate, however kitchen areas can fluctuate in temperature level, especially throughout summer heatwaves or near ovens. The majority of fridges offered in the UK are rated "N" (Normal) or "SN" (Subnormal), designed for ambient temperatures between 10 ° C and 32 ° C. If you are putting your fridge in an unheated garage or outbuilding, ensure you Buy Fridges a model specifically designed for "Garage Ready" or lower ambient temperature levels, or the compressor may fail.
Frost-Free Technology
In the past, defrosting the freezer was a task every couple of months. Modern "overall no-frost" innovation distributes chilled air to prevent ice accumulation, maintaining food quality and saving you from the difficult task of manual defrosting.

6.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: Does my fridge need to be plumbed in?A: Only if you decide for a design with an integrated water dispenser or automated ice maker. If you do not have water connections nearby, try to find designs with an internal water tank that you fill by hand.
Q: How much area should I leave around a freestanding fridge?A: It is generally advised to leave a minimum of 5cm of clearance on the sides and top, and 10cm at the back to enable appropriate air flow. Check your handbook, as some modern-day "zero-clearance" hinges enable for tighter fits.
Q: Why is my fridge making humming sounds?A: A low hum is normal for a compressor. Nevertheless, if it is louder than usual, examine that it is level, not touching the wall, and that the internal contents aren't vibrating versus the walls.
Q: How long can a fridge generally last?A: A well-maintained mid-to-high-range fridge must last between 10 and 15 years.
Q: Is it worth repairing an old fridge?A: If the repair includes the compressor or coolant system, it is typically more cost-efficient to change the system, especially if the existing design mishandles. Basic repairs like door seals or thermostats are typically worth the financial investment.
